Facilities include a library and science and computer
laboratoriies, as well as playgrounds for football,
cricket, basketball, volleyball and for physical
education classes.
Science Laboratories
An important part of science studies, the Chemistry,
Physics and Biology Laboratories provide the practical
experience necessary for better understanding
of scientific concepts.
Library and Resource Centre
All three of the School sections have a library
and a resource centre equipped with computers.
The largest is in the School’s senior section.
Regular annual budgeting for library resources,
together with support from the Asia Foundation,
enables the School to add a significant number
of books to the collection.
Computer Laboratory
The School has a large computer lab in the senior
section and mini labs in the primary and junior
sections. In August 2003, 40 teachers received
ICT training in the use of technology across
the curriculum. Further training was provided
in 2004 as the school moves to implement a computerized
management system.

Heritage Centre
Through an International
Academic Partnership grant, a Cultural Heritage
Centre was established in 2002. Since the students
are from an urban environment, very few have the
experience of village life, which is such an important
part of Bengali culture. The Heritage Centre,
located in the primary building, displays a collection
of tools, fabrics, models, pictures, pots and
musical instruments representing rural life.
Students visit the centre as part of their Bangla
language, social studies and creative writing
classes. The Heritage Centre helps to bring reality
to the folk stories that abound in Bangladesh.
